Finland has big problem with Canada on NA rinks.
1975 1-2
1978 no game
1982 1-5
1986 5-6
1989 3-4
1991 1-5
1995 4-6
1996 1-3
1999 4-6
2003 3-5
2005 1-8
2006 1-5 and 0-4
2009 no game
2010 no game
2012 1-8 and 0-4
2015 1-4
2017 no game
15 games , 15 losses
